Abstract
The graphics annotation is an interaction technique through which the teachers and the students may enhance the visual communication based on free expression forms, practical and artistic ability, imagination, and creativity. This paper explores the knowledge assessment techniques based on the 3D annotations. A few cases are exemplified on the medical elearning objects.
